Save problem with Drakan 2
Hi!
I have saving progress problem with Drakan: The ancient gates. With PCSX2 0.9.5 the game works fine. For graphic I used GSdx9. The game works perfectly just a little bit slow when there is a lot of fog, smoke or when you are flying over the big area. There is one thing that I cannot figure out how to fix it. When I try to travel into the opened gate to Surdana (first or the second) the game asks me for saving the game (you cannot continue the game without saving). It start's to save the game and when bar comes to the half then save progress jumps at the beginnig and stops in the middle. If I wait 5 minutes, the emulator crashes. I have Intel pentium 3800 dual core, 2Gb RAM DDR2, Geforce 6600 SE, Win XP SP2. How do I get through this saves when going through the aincent gates? Can anyone please help me with this? Or at least tell me where can I find the answer? Thank you |
